Why do I keep gaining weight? by Beautiful_Scheme_829 in diet

[–]Short-State-2017 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I understand, and I wouldn’t worry too much on getting the perfect diet (it’s why people tend to fall off, binge etc). Genuinely based on your size you can definitely eat more than 1800 calories, more like 2200. But the type of strict diet you’re talking about is extremely difficult to just follow constantly. Be kind to yourself, if you slip up it’s ok. Food isn’t the enemy, and those things you mentioned in moderation aren’t going to kill you.

But yes, maybe not 5k, but 3k “binges” will still derail you. Idk how many times a week you do it, but if you have 4 2k days, and 3 3k days, your weekly average calories is 17k, when it should be 14k. That brings your daily average to 2.4-2.5k a day instead of 2k.

Is it 1g per target pound, or 1g per kg? by monsieuro3o in naturalbodybuilding

[–]Short-State-2017 1 point2 points  (0 children)

If you’re relatively lean 1.6-2.2g per kg body weight. If you’re overweight, do the same but for lean body mass, or for your goal weight. For example, if you’re a 130kg guy and your goal weight is 100kg there’s no need for you to be having 250g+ protein - 180g will do that job.
